Molly Breeding: Creamsicle Lyretail + Silver Sailfin Lyretail =
6 Gold Dust
2 Green
3 Stillborn
How did that happen? My gold dust is female, not pregnant, and different body/fin shape than the rest of my mollies, whereas the mother molly is lyretail, longer fins, and creamsicle, and the father was silver with green/blue shimmer, sailfin, and lyretail. So where did the Gold Dust come in this breeding? I was all excited hoping for beautiful silvers and creamsicles and maybe a few green. Too early to tell if i got any sailfins or lyretails, but the coloring has me completely stunned and confused. I thought i had my gene pool perfect to make brilliant colored huge finned mollies. :( Has anybody done any dabbling in molly genetics to help me figure out the proper mate for the female to make the right fry next time?
By the way by Gold Dust i mean yellow/gold with black half of bodies and tails. Creamsicle i mean bright orange with white bellies. Silver i mean the pure white ones with no spots at all. when fish farms churn out fish, they dont really care much about strain purity and stuff like that. it is entirely possible that both mollies may have had gold mollies somewhere in their ancestry and thus contained "hidden" gold dust molly genes.
